Biography
After his naval service he attended University of Toronto, then joined Ford of Canada Sales Division 1949. Retired in 1980 as Operating Manager Dealer Development. Then General Manager of GM Dealers Association of Toronto & District retiring in May 1991.
 
Military Service
He was appointed as an AC 2/c RCAF (With seniority dated 01/06/1942). He served in RCAF Toronto for Pre-flight Training 1942. He served in RCAF Edmonton for Pre-Flight Training 1942. He served in RCAF Windsor for #7 Elementary Flying Training School. He served in RCAF Centralia for Service Flying Training School. He was Awarded Wings 22/03/1943. (CFR 22/03/1943). He was appointed as a Pilot Officer RCAF (With seniority dated 22/03/1943). He served in RCAF Maitland NS for #1 AGTS for Command Course. He served in RCAF Trenton in #1 FTS for Flying Instructor Course. He served in RCAF Fort MacLeod as Flying Instructor. He served in RCAF Vulcan as Flying Instructor, (Transferred to RNVR 1945). He was appointed as a Sub-Lieutenant (A) (Temp.) RNVR 1945. He served in H.M.S. Macaw for AFU 1945. He served in RNAS Peplow for OUT. He served in RNAS Hinstock for 758 RN Squadron 1945. He served in RNAS Lee-on-Solent for 760 RN Squadron 1945. (He was demobilized 01/01/1946).

Aircraft Flown Total Flying Hours: 1,000. Service Aircraft Flown: Tiger Moth, Anson II, Harvard, Cessna Crane, Oxford, Corsair. Civilian Aircraft Flown: Aeronca, Stnson Voyager
